// 数组翻转
var arr = ['red', 'green', 'blue', 'pink'];
for (var i = 0; i < arr.length / 2; i++) { // i < arr.length / 2 中除以2 是因为两边交换完为一半 ,如果不除以2 相当于又交换回来了
var temp = arr[i] //声明一个变量 存储数组元素中的值
arr[i] = arr[arr.length - i - 1] // 把数组元素中的值 交还给 数组最后一个元素的值 (其中的 第一个i 是为了对应 后边要转换的 i。)
arr[arr.length - i - 1] = temp // 再交换回来
}
console.log(arr);